Cisco Launches Sovereign Infrastructure Portfolio in EMEA

Summary

Cisco has launched its Sovereign Critical Infrastructure (SCI) portfolio across Europe, the Middle East, and Africa (EMEA) to help organizations maintain control over their data and digital infrastructure. This portfolio includes networking, security, compute, collaboration, network management, AI, and Splunk products, which can be configured for air-gapped and on-premises deployments. The launch responds to increasing demands for data sovereignty among public sector bodies and regulated industries facing pressure to keep sensitive data under national control. Cisco's initiative aims to support organizations in various sectors, including government, energy, transport, healthcare, and financial services, as they navigate the complexities of digital sovereignty. The portfolio is designed to be flexible, catering to different operational needs, whether fully on-premises or hybrid setups. Cisco has also expanded its Customer Experience organization to provide support for these sovereign environments. The launch reflects a broader trend among technology suppliers towards localized operating models amid rising geopolitical risks. Cisco did not disclose specific pricing or customer numbers for the new portfolio.
